Advantech introduces new HMI Line for PLC Control

Advantech Automation Corp. (www.advantech.com/ea) is proud to announce the release of the WOP-2000 series for applications that involve the use of motion/thermal controllers, PLCs, sensors and inverters. The new series is bundled with a PM Designer 2.0 – a software development kit which creates application solutions for easy control of machines within the factory, labor-saving and improved efficiency of manufacturing. The WOP-2000 series provides a great price performance ratio for several markets, including HMI + communication gateways, conventional operator panels and HMI + low mini SCADA systems.

The easy-to-use PM Designer features high-end vector graphics, solution-oriented screen objects, Microsoft Windows(TM) fonts for multi-language applications, operation logging, data loggers, alarms and recipes. The integrated development tool also includes online/offline simulation and other utility programs like Data Transfer Helper (DTH); text editors and recipes editors. The series’ runtime, which is part of PM Designer, guarantees performance and reliability because of high communication data rates, sub-second screen switching, minimum system overhead and 24/7 operation.

The new series consists of up to 200MHz ARM9-based processors and 4 to 16MB flash memory. It can support several LCD sizes from 3.5 inches to 12.1 inches and is best suited for applications that involve the use of motion/thermal controllers, PLCs, inverters and sensors.

With a variety of communication interfaces such as RS-232/422/485 Ethernet and USB ports, the series can be easily connected to several equipments. Its monitors boast SVGA TFT LCDs with 800×600 resolution and 64K colors for clear displays in any factory setting. Moreover, the product includes 0 to 50° C operating temperatures and NEMA 4/IP65 protection to guarantee performance in hash environments.

The series is compatible with more than 250 of the most popular PLCs, such as Modicon Quantum™ series, Allen Bradley Micrologix series, Siemens AG Simatic S7 series, GE series 90™, Omron Corporation Sysmac C/CV/CS/CJ series, Yaskawa Corp. MP series and Mitsubishi Electric Corp. FX/Q series.
